In the realm of professional expertise, understanding the material composition of rubber hoses underscores their application in specific tasks. Rubber, with its inherent flexibility, provides an excellent medium for transferring fluids. For 3/8-inch hoses, manufacturers often blend natural and synthetic rubber to achieve a product that offers excellent abrasion resistance, flexibility, and resilience. This combination is especially pertinent in harsh working environments where other materials might falter.
